The decode: what the loop is doing, and why it must stop

What caused it: a complete power loss while the system was running. Everything the machine had outstanding — writes queued in memory, structures mid-update, files open — was lost at that instant, and the filesystem was left in a state it could not be sure of. On the next start-up the system noticed and did what it is designed to do: attempt a repair.

Why it is looping rather than finishing: the repair is not completing. It starts, works on structures it cannot reconcile, fails or hangs, and the machine restarts into the same routine. That cycle can continue indefinitely, and to somebody watching it looks like a machine waiting for something.

Why that is the damaging part, and it is the reason to act now: a repair is a write. It reads the filing structures, decides what they should be, and writes that conclusion back. So a machine looping through repair attempts is writing its conclusions to the volume over and over — each time from information it has already partly altered. Every cycle is another chance to discard entries it cannot verify, which on this kind of fault are precisely the files that were open or recently modified.

So the instruction is simple: hold the power button until it switches off, and leave it off. Not restart it to see whether it gets further, not let it run overnight in the hope of completing. The loop achieves nothing and costs something on every pass.

Why the drive is probably fine: a power loss does not damage a drive. It damages the coherence of what was being written at that moment, which is a logical fault on undamaged hardware. Her guess about a corrupt drive is understandable and the word doing the work is corrupt rather than drive.

What she did right: bought a replacement machine, which means the affected one can come out of service entirely rather than being needed and therefore repeatedly restarted. Most people in this position keep trying because they have no alternative computer.

What is done instead: the drive is removed and read independently, imaged before any reconstruction, and the structures rebuilt against the copy — where a wrong conclusion costs nothing and can be repeated. Filesystems keep backup copies of their key structures at known positions, and where the automatic repair has already rewritten the primary set, those copies are frequently what returns files with folders and names intact.

On the bench

The machine was powered down immediately and not restarted — an automatic repair being a write operation, so a looping machine writes its conclusions to the volume on every pass, each time from information it has already partly altered. The drive was removed and read independently of the host, imaged write-blocked before any reconstruction, and pre-repair structures located from their surviving backup copies, since the repair cycle rewrites the primary set while duplicates elsewhere survive. Files were validated by opening.
